Robert Owen (14 May 1771 – 17 November 1858), a Welsh textile manufacturer, philanthropist and social reformer, was one founder of utopian socialism and the cooperative movement. He is known for efforts to improve factory working conditions for his workers and promote experimental socialistic communities.

The economy of China was rooted by trading of many products which consists of manufactured goods, of which electrical and electronic machinery, equipment, clothing, textiles and footwear are by far the most important. Agricultural products, chemicals and fuels are also significant products for trade.

Intrinsic motivation: In psychology, the term intrinsic motivation is defined as the behavior of an individual that is being driven by the internal rewards. In other words, the intrinsic motivation refers to the process in which an individual's behavior is involved or engaged that comes from inside the person and often leads to satisfy him or her.
Example: A person plays football because it satisfies him or her internally and feels accomplished.
